Jittery, old-fashioned punk rock is The Job’s stock and trade. The arrogant, bastard love child of Joe Strummer and Andy Partridge; The Job snarl through songs of resentment, riot and rebellion.To promote their self-titled debut album, and its forthcoming tour, The Job are working together with Canadian publicists The Musebox. They’ve also picked up a sponsorship deal from Mill St. Brewery which involves giveaways and promotions at The Job’s live shows.

A fervent belief in rock & roll took these four boys from good homes in sleepy southwestern Ontario and shaped them into the fierce, frenetic foursome known today as The Job. Members Nyles Miszczyk, Jason Holinaty, Mark Johnston, and Danny Miles have been playing together since early 2007 when they formed the band (originally called Howl) in the back room of Grooves Records in London Ontario. They have since moved their operation to Toronto in search of greater opportunities and wider successes. They’ve built a large & loyal fanbase through touring consistently and have garnered great critical acclaim.
